What Is MATLAB Compiler?

MATLAB Compiler™ enables you to share MATLAB® programs as standalone applications, web apps, and Docker container images. Check out more on MATLAB Compiler: https://bit.ly/3chL8ts

With MATLAB Compiler, you can also package and deploy MATLAB programs as MapReduce and Spark™ big data applications or as Microsoft® Excel® Add-ins. End users can run your applications royalty-free with MATLAB Runtime or embed them directly within your compiled applications. MATLAB Runtime is a set of shared libraries required to run artifacts generated with MATLAB Compiler, which is free to download from mathworks.com.

You can generate different targets using MATLAB Compiler such as the standalone application, which you can create from MATLAB programs or from apps developed using MATLAB App Designer. Use the Application Compiler to package the main file and any associated files into the installer. You can also customize your application with a unique startup image and provide additional text information. Then, package your files and provide the generated installer to your end users, who can install and run it like any other desktop application. 

Using the development version of MATLAB Web App Server™ included with MATLAB Compiler, you can develop and test out the web apps workflow. Users interact with web apps in a browser without needing to install any additional software. As your MATLAB apps require further capabilities, such as authentication, you can adopt the MATLAB Web App Server product, which also supports interacting with apps created from different MATLAB releases.

You can package and distribute your standalone applications as self-contained Docker images. The container image consists of the application, optimized MATLAB Runtime components, and operating system libraries. 

Additionally, you can create custom functions for Microsoft Excel by packaging MATLAB programs as Excel Add-ins. Excel users access these custom functions just as they would with any native function to perform analyses. 

With MATLAB Compiler, you can generate standalone applications, web apps, and other targets that fit your deployment needs to distribute your applications to users whether or not they have MATLAB and Simulink®.
